Resumo

Apesar de a canoagem não ser um esporte particularmente popular na Espanha, é uma das disciplinas olímpicas que mais sucesso proporcionou ao medalhista espanhol. Este grande desempenho da canoagem espanhola pode ser atribuído ao trabalho dos clubes e das federações regionais (FFAA), que são capazes de otimizar os escassos recursos de que dispõem, principalmente de transferências públicas. federações espanholas de canoagem (FFAAP) durante o ciclo olímpico 2013-2016 usando a técnica Data Envelopment Analysis (DEA) e o índice de Malmquist. Uma segunda análise tenta identificar os principais fatores que levam à eficiência das federações. Os resultados mostram que, apesar das diferenças importantes entre as Forças Armadas, não existe um caminho único para alcançar a eficiência. Em geral, a disponibilidade de recursos aumenta as chances de obtenção de resultados, enquanto os treinadores e a competição interna ajudam a otimizar o desempenho dos recursos disponíveis.
